Top 4:
Brandon Knuezer vs. James Naegele – James wins, full defeat. I didn't watch much of this game as I was helping handle prizes for the other players, but apparently James made a nice Boba for Mara trade and that gave him enough of an edge to get the full kill.
Brian Re vs. Matt Belmont – Brian wins, close game with killing Loda at the last roll to get the win. It was super close overall, and Matt didn't realize that he was far enough ahead on points that he just had to keep Loda alive to win. Brian wouldn't have been able to kill enough of a combination of other pieces in order to get ahead. But Loda was Disrupted and out of FPs, so it was just down to Brian's Han/Leia rolls, and not only did he get high enough rolls, Leia actually landed a crit, and Loda went down, giving Brian the win.
Finals:
Brian Re vs. James Naegele – Brian made a nice move to take out Ganner in Round 2, but James got a solid move to kill Leia in Round 3, and it went downhill from there. James had a lot of bad rolls with Han in the Swiss rounds, but the karma came back as Han Crit and hit to kill Luke with Cunning at the beginning of Round 4 (he was Disrupted and missed his Deflect roll as well). At that point, Han and Mara both had full HP still, with Kol down to 90. Brian’s Ferus and Han were forced to move up and engage, but between missed attacks, and then another lost initiative, they both quickly died too. From that point, Brian’s ERC was really the only thing that could do much damage at that point, so James took the win at that point.

To me, the most important thing about these events is the fun, and making sure that people leave, having got their $15 worth. I will plan to put up some pictures later in the week as they become available. Some of the things we did included door prizes for Art Prints by Scott Simmons (who also did the T Shirt artwork). We gave away a Jedicartographer Map Pack 2 and a Mapmaker Exodus/Offworld Shipping Center map. We offerred for players to buy Raffle tickets at $1 a piece (which went back into the prize support), and then we raffled off the original artwork that was used to design the T Shirts, and then also some custom minis (hopefully pictures later, as they turned out nice). We also gave extra prizes out to people who lost their games each round, including some Rs from various sets. And then Ira, who came in last place, got a goodie bag which included a Cay Qel-Droma! I also put together a quick set of all 8 Dejarik Monsters, and printed and laminated a 12x12 dejarik table and the 1-page rule sheet, and gave that away as a door prize as well.
And even though we only had 11 players, between the extra money from the Raffles, and a bit thrown in from the T Shirt sales (our guy who makes the T Shirts is EXTREMELY generous! Thanks, Matt!), we were able to squeeze just enough to give James his $90 for winning the tournament, and still get 1 case (thanks to Sci-Fi city for giving us a discount on the product!), which was enough to give everybody at least 1 booster, on top of all the other prize stuff.
